Questions & Answers
Q: What is natural frequency in dynamic vibration analysis?
Natural frequency refers to the frequency at which an object vibrates without external force, defined as sqrt(k/m) where k is stiffness and m is mass. It plays a crucial role in modal analysis and resonance phenomena.
Q: What are the three types of external excitation analysis in dynamic vibration analysis?
The three types are frequency response (sinusoidal excitation), transient response (time-dependent excitation), and random vibration analysis (random nature of loading).
Q: How does modal analysis help in understanding dynamic vibrations?
Modal analysis focuses on the natural frequencies of a structure, leading to resonance phenomena identification crucial for designing against vibrations, resonances, and potential failure modes.
Q: Why is transient dynamic analysis important in vibration analysis?
Transient dynamic analysis helps in understanding how vibrations change over time, crucial for assessing structures' response to varying input forces and accelerations.
Summary & Key Takeaways
-
Dynamic analysis involves free vibration analysis (natural frequency) and forced vibration analysis (external excitation).
-
There are three types of external excitation analysis: frequency response, transient response, and random vibration.
-
Modal analysis, transient dynamic analysis, random vibration analysis, and seismic analysis are all crucial in understanding and mitigating vibrations.
